Application for approval of the Buslines Group Bus Drivers (Orange) Enterprise Agreement 2015.
[1] An application has been made for approval of an enterprise agreement known as the Buslines Group Bus Drivers (Orange) Enterprise Agreement 2015 (the Agreement). The application was made pursuant to s.185 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act) by Buslines Group Pty Ltd T/A Orange Buslines. The Agreement is a single-enterprise agreement.
[2] I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ss186, 187 and 188 as are relevant to this application for approval have been met.
[3] The Agreement is approved and, in accordance with s.54, will operate from 15 December 2015. The nominal expiry date is 30 June 2019.
